Industrial bedroom design embraces raw materials, urban aesthetics, and a contemporary edge, creating a unique and stylish sanctuary. Explore the key elements and design principles to transform your bedroom into an industrial retreat.

1. Raw and Exposed Materials:
At the core of industrial design is the use of raw and exposed materials. Embrace the beauty of exposed brick walls, concrete floors, and unfinished ceilings. These elements add a rugged and authentic urban charm to the bedroom.

2. Utilitarian Furniture Pieces:
Opt for utilitarian furniture that showcases simplicity and functionality. Industrial bedroom design often features metal bed frames, sturdy wooden dressers, and bedside tables with a no-nonsense aesthetic. The focus is on practicality without sacrificing style.

3. Metal Accents and Fixtures:
Metal plays a crucial role in industrial design. Integrate metal accents through light fixtures, bed frames, and decorative elements. The contrast between the warm tones of wood and the cool, industrial feel of metal contributes to the overall visual appeal.

4. Neutral Color Palette with Pops of Contrast:
Keep the color palette neutral, leaning towards shades of gray, brown, and black. Introduce pops of contrast with bold colors like deep red, navy, or industrial greens. This adds visual interest to the space and prevents it from feeling too monotone.

5. Industrial Lighting Fixtures:
Select industrial-inspired lighting fixtures to illuminate the bedroom. Pendant lights with exposed bulbs, factory-style sconces, or metal cage lamps enhance the industrial ambiance. These fixtures often serve as statement pieces while providing practical lighting.

6. Reclaimed and Upcycled Decor:
Incorporate reclaimed and upcycled decor items to infuse character into the industrial bedroom. Salvaged wooden pallets transformed into wall art, repurposed industrial crates as bedside tables, or vintage signage contribute to the eclectic charm.

7. Open Shelving and Storage:
Industrial design favors open shelving and storage solutions. Opt for metal shelving units, floating shelves, or wire baskets to keep the bedroom organized while showcasing industrial-style decor items. This adds an uncluttered and utilitarian feel.

8. Statement Artwork and Murals:
Make a bold statement with industrial-themed artwork or murals. Large-scale prints of urban landscapes, industrial machinery, or graffiti-style murals can serve as focal points, adding an edgy and artistic dimension to the bedroom.

9. Urban Textures and Fabrics:
Incorporate urban textures and fabrics to enhance the industrial vibe. Linen, canvas, and leather are popular choices for bedding and upholstery. These materials contribute to a tactile and inviting atmosphere while maintaining the industrial aesthetic.

10. Embracing Minimalism:
Industrial bedroom design often aligns with minimalist principles. Keep decor and furnishings simple, focusing on functionality and clean lines. A clutter-free environment promotes a sense of calm and highlights the distinctive features of the industrial style.
